EPA v. Bland, Schroeder, Archer, LP. and Palisades Developers, LTD.

Unilateral Administrative Order Without Adjudication

Case summary

Violations: 1. The SWPPP does not include a description of appropriate control measures that will be implemented as part of the construction activity to control pollutants in storm water discharges. 2. There are not adequate controls to prevent discharges of solids and building materials . 3. There are no construction-phase erosion and sediment controls designed to retain sediment on site to the extent practicable. 4. Control measures are not properly installed, selected, or maintained at the construction site. 5. Sediment is not being removed from sediment traps or sedimentation ponds when design capacity has been reduced by 50%. 6. All erosion and sediment control measures and other protective measures identified in the SWPPP are not being maintained and are not in effective operating condition. **RELIEF SOUGHT: 1) Within thirty days, Respondents shall take whatever corrective action is necessary to correct the deficiencies, eliminate and prevent recurrence of the violations, and submit a written report detailing the specific actions taken; 2) If complete correction of the violations is not possible within thirty days, submit a comprehensive plan to do so; and 4) Within forty-five days, arrange a Show Cause meeting with EPA
